Feedback-Driven Sales Improvement

In today’s fast moving market, sales growth is no longer driven by assumptions it is shaped by feedback. Every interaction, whether successful or not, carries insights that can refine strategy, improve performance, and strengthen customer relationships.

Sales today is not just about pushing forward it is about listening, learning, and evolving continuously.

1. Feedback Reveals the Real Buying Experience

Customers see your process differently than you do. Their feedback highlights gaps, friction points, and missed expectations that internal teams often overlook.

2. Lost Deals Carry the Most Valuable Insights

Wins feel good, but losses teach more. Understanding why a deal didn’t close helps refine messaging, pricing strategy, and positioning.

3. Continuous Improvement Beats Static Strategy

Markets change, buyer behaviour shifts, and expectations evolve. Feedback ensures your sales approach stays relevant instead of outdated.

4. Listening Builds Stronger Relationships

When customers feel heard, they feel valued. Even critical feedback, when acknowledged and acted upon, strengthens trust.

5. Internal Feedback Aligns Teams Better

Sales teams, marketing, and support all see different parts of the customer journey. Sharing feedback across teams creates a more unified and effective strategy.

6. Small Adjustments Create Big Results

Minor improvements in communication, response time, or clarity based on feedback can significantly increase conversion rates.

7. Feedback Turns Experience into Strategy

Data shows what happened. Feedback explains why it happened. Together, they create smarter decision making.

Conclusion

In 2026, the most successful sales professionals are not the ones who talk the most they are the ones who listen the best.

Feedback driven selling transforms every interaction into an opportunity for growth. It builds smarter strategies, stronger relationships, and more consistent results.

The best professionals do not just sell they improve with every conversation.
